Abu Dhabi may build a Formula One track near Bulgaria’s capital of Sofia.
Abu Dhabi sheikh Mohammed Abdul Jalil al Blouki and Bulgarian Minister of Economy, Energy and Tourism Traicho Traikov signed an agreement for economic cooperation.
The construction of a Formula One track is the first project idea for cooperation in the sphere of economy between Abu Dhabi and Bulgaria.
The two countries will examine further project details during coming meetings.
A joint company will work on the project development. The agreement includes common management of the future track and organization of events part of the program of Formula One World Championship.
Mohammed Abdul Jalil al Blouki is the president of state Emirates Associate Business Group (EABG).
The sheikh met Bulgarian Prime Minister Boiko Borisov. They talked about opportunities for Abu Dhabi investment in infrastructure projects in Bulgaria.
